Starling Bank, the UK-based challenger bank known for its innovative app-based banking and rapid growth, is reportedly eyeing a significant acquisition in the United States as part of its ambitious international expansion strategy. While the company remains tight-lipped about specific targets, the whispers of a potential US bank acquisition have sent ripples through the fintech industry and ignited considerable speculation among analysts and investors. This move would represent a bold step for Starling, marking a significant escalation in its global ambitions beyond its already successful UK operations.
Starling's expansion into the US market is a strategic move driven by the immense potential of the American financial technology sector. However, the path to market dominance is multifaceted. The company faces a choice: pursue organic growth, a slower, more resource-intensive approach, or leverage a strategic acquisition to gain immediate market share and established infrastructure. While Starling hasn't disclosed potential targets, analysts are speculating about various possibilities. The focus is likely on smaller, regional banks or fintech companies with a strong digital presence. These targets offer a blend of established infrastructure and a digitally native customer base, aligning with Starling's own strengths.
The US banking sector is ripe with opportunities for consolidation, with many smaller banks struggling to compete with larger institutions and the rise of digital-first competitors. This creates a fertile ground for acquisitions, particularly for well-capitalized and innovative players like Starling. The key for Starling will be identifying a target that offers a strong strategic fit, a manageable integration process, and a compelling financial return on investment.
Starling's potential US expansion faces stiff competition from established players and formidable fintech giants. Companies like Chime, Revolut, and others already have a strong presence in the US market, while traditional banks are aggressively investing in digital transformation initiatives.
This competitive landscape necessitates a well-defined strategy, robust execution, and a clear value proposition that resonates with US consumers. Starling's success will depend on its ability to differentiate itself from competitors and carve out a unique niche within the US market.
